KinderCare Learning Centers offers childcare and early childhood education. 

What is the discount?

The KinderCare Learning Centers military discount is that they have partnered with Child Care Aware of America to offer fee assistance to address childcare needs when care at an on-base Child Development Center isn’t available. They also offer a childcare subsidy program administered through the USDA.

Who’s Eligible?

The fee assistance is for eligible active duty military families and the subsidy program is for eligible active duty members or active duty reservists of the US Coast Guard called to action for 180 days or longer, US National Park Services, US Customs and Border Protection, and US General Services Administration that don’t live or work near a CDC. Eligibility does vary by program.

About KinderCare Learning Centers

KinderCare Learning Centers were founded by Perry Mendel, a real estate developer, after speculating that the increasing numbers of women entering the workforce will increase the demand for preschool care. They began as Kinder-Care Nursery Schools with the first facility opening in 1969, with 70 children. The second facility opened in 1970, and then the name was changed to Kinder-Care Learning Centers. By 1971, 19 centers were in operation and the first infant care was offered. 

Over the years they have acquired different companies including Sylvan Learning Centers in 1987. In 1992, they became KinderCare Learning Centers. In 2005, they were acquired by the Knowledge Learning Corporation division of Knowledge Universe. In 2015, Partners Group bought Knowledge Universe. Knowledge Universe was renamed as KinderCare Education in 2016. You can find them in 39 states, and Washington DC. They have over 2,000 centers, including before and after-school programs as well as employer-sponsored centers. Their headquarters are in Portland, OR
